Abstract:
The invention comprises an automated system 10 for the accurate positioning of movable parts bins 16 in relation to a preferred fixed location 26. The automated system consists of a number of movable parts bins 16 arranged on a conveyor 14 which is driven by a drive mechanism 18. The drive mechanism 18 controllably moves the conveyor 14 and therefore the bins 16 to desired locations in association with a coarse position sensor 24 and a final approach sensor 26. Both the sensors and the conveyor drive mechanism are interconnected with an electronic controller 28. This electronic controller monitors the position sensors in order to control the drive mechanism in a manner which positions the preselected parts bin at the desired location.
